Dear all,
The proposal has been made to obsolete
GO:0043429 2-nonaprenyl-6-methoxy-1,4-benzoquinone methyltransferase activity GO:0043428 2-heptaprenyl-6-methoxy-1,4-benzoquinone methyltransferase activity GO:0043430 2-decaprenyl-6-methoxy-1,4-benzoquinone methyltransferase activity GO:0043334 2-hexaprenyl-6-methoxy-1,4-benzoquinone methyltransferase activity GO:0043333 2-octaprenyl-6-methoxy-1,4-benzoquinone methylase activity
since these represent species-specific substrates, as stated in the EC comment: "Ubiquinones from different organisms have a different number of prenyl units" and "However, the enzyme usually shows a low degree of specificity regarding the number of prenyl units.". These will be replaced by the parent term " GO:0008425 2-polyprenyl-6-methoxy-1,4-benzoquinone methyltransferase activity"
The parent of GO:0008425, 'GO:0030580 quinone cofactor methyltransferase activity' will also be obsoleted and replaced by GO:0008425, since these describe the same reaction.

EC:2.1.1.201 says: Name: 2-methoxy-6-polyprenyl-1,4-benzoquinol methylase Reaction: a 2-methoxy-6-all-trans-polyprenyl-1,4-benzoquinol + S-adenosyl-L-methionine <=> a 6-methoxy-3-methyl-2-all-trans-polyprenyl-1,4-benzoquinol + H(+) + S-adenosyl-L-homocysteine
Comments: Ubiquinones from different organisms have a different number of prenyl units (for example, ubiquinone-6 in Saccharomyces, ubiquinone- 9 in rat and ubiquinone-10 in human), and thus the natural substrate for the enzymes from different organisms has a different number of prenyl units. However, the enzyme usually shows a low degree of specificity regarding the number of prenyl units.
